Output e0881c3cde69404d4cb4f191242785c67bbf06d90a577420343177598f31dc6b:2

value
117484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aba57449e8d144e591489870bee0d04edafb539 OP_EQUAL
address
39xjxzz9ekTkdXuriwMAGE4o5KzeqFaieg
transaction
e0881c3cde69404d4cb4f191242785c67bbf06d90a577420343177598f31dc6b
spent
true